Abstract

A new genus and species of Stratiomyidae, Gigantoberis liaoningensis, is described from the Lower Cretaceous of western Liaoning Province based on a well-preserved, complete specimen. This is the first fossil record of a soldier fly so far described from China. It was armed with a specialized mouth part (proboscis and labella) and its huge body and short wings imply that it was a pollen eater and a poor flier.
